Out & About Community Services is a Community Interest Company (CIC) based in London and Dorset. We support people with learning disabilities to enable them to have access to their community, and enjoy their choice of activities in mainstream venues.
Our Ethos
We take a relationship-based approach. This means creating strong relationships with our service users, which provides opportunities for them to develop and change.
We are person-centred. The focus is on the person and what they can do, not on their disability. Our support focuses on achieving the person's aspirations and being tailored to meet their particular needs and circumstance.
We are outcome-focused. This means that we aim to achieve the priorities that service users themselves identify as being important.

Where Do We Work?
Currently Out & About delivers services in several London Boroughs, including Barking & Dagenham, Ealing and Southwark. We also provide a service in Dorset.
